Understanding Alpha and Omega Peptides
For a more complete grasp of bioactive peptides, it's essential to define alpha and omega peptides. Fundamentally, these point to the ending amino acids within a peptide chain . Alpha peptides display a free amino group (-NH2) at their N-terminus, signifying they are the starting amino acid included during peptide creation . Conversely, omega peptides have a free carboxyl group (-COOH) at their C-terminus, representing the last amino acid added . Understanding this fundamental distinction is vital in protein study and innovation of new therapies and applications .
